The future of non-ferrous castings is shaped by several key trends, including increasing demand for lightweight and corrosion-resistant materials in automotive, aerospace, and marine applications, advancements in casting processes and alloy development, and growing emphasis on performance, cost-effectiveness, and sustainability. Non-ferrous castings, made from metals such as aluminum, copper, and magnesium, offer properties such as high strength-to-weight ratio, thermal conductivity, and design flexibility, making them ideal for a wide range of industrial and consumer products. With the rise of electrification, fuel efficiency, and emissions reduction goals in transportation and infrastructure sectors, there's a growing need for non-ferrous castings that offer superior mechanical properties, dimensional accuracy, and surface finish while minimizing material waste and energy consumption in manufacturing processes. Moreover, advancements in casting technologies such as die casting, sand casting, and investment casting are driving the development of advanced casting methods with improved yield, process control, and sustainability for producing complex and high-performance components in various industries. Additionally, the integration of non-ferrous castings into innovative product designs such as lightweight vehicle structures, energy-efficient HVAC systems, and durable consumer goods is enabling the development of next-generation products that meet the evolving needs of end-users and regulatory requirements. A significant trend in the non-ferrous castings market is the increasing demand for lightweight and high-performance materials. Non-ferrous castings, such as those made from aluminum, copper, and magnesium alloys, are sought after for their ability to offer superior strength-to-weight ratios compared to ferrous metals like cast iron and steel. With industries such as automotive, aerospace, and electronics placing greater emphasis on fuel efficiency, sustainability, and performance, there's a growing preference for non-ferrous castings in applications where weight reduction and structural integrity are critical. This trend is driven by advancements in casting technologies, material science, and design optimization, enabling manufacturers to produce complex, lightweight components with improved mechanical properties. As industries continue to prioritize lightweighting initiatives to meet regulatory requirements and consumer expectations for efficiency and sustainability, the demand for non-ferrous castings is expected to grow.
A major driver of the non-ferrous castings market is the expansion of infrastructure and construction projects worldwide. Non-ferrous castings find applications in infrastructure projects such as bridges, pipelines, and structural components where corrosion resistance, durability, and design flexibility are essential. Additionally, the construction industry utilizes non-ferrous castings for architectural elements, decorative features, and building facades due to their aesthetic appeal and weather resistance properties. The growth in urbanization, population, and economic development drives the demand for infrastructure investments, creating opportunities for non-ferrous casting manufacturers. Moreover, government initiatives aimed at modernizing infrastructure, improving transportation networks, and promoting sustainable development further stimulate demand for non-ferrous castings. As construction activities continue to expand globally, particularly in emerging markets, the demand for non-ferrous castings in construction applications is expected to remain strong.
An opportunity within the non-ferrous castings market lies in penetration into renewable energy and green technologies. Non-ferrous castings play a vital role in renewable energy systems such as wind turbines, solar panels, and hydroelectric generators, where lightweight, corrosion-resistant components are required to withstand harsh environmental conditions. Additionally, non-ferrous alloys are used in energy-efficient technologies such as electric vehicles, battery systems, and energy storage solutions to improve performance and extend service life. With the global shift towards clean energy and sustainability, there's a growing demand for non-ferrous castings in green technologies that support renewable energy generation, storage, and distribution. The largest segment in the Non-ferrous Castings Market is Aluminum. This dominance is primarily due to the widespread use of aluminum castings across various industries. Aluminum is prized for its lightweight yet durable properties, making it highly desirable for applications where weight reduction, corrosion resistance, and high strength-to-weight ratio are essential. Industries such as automotive, aerospace, construction, and consumer goods extensively utilize aluminum castings for components ranging from engine parts and structural components to consumer electronics and household appliances. Additionally, aluminum's excellent thermal conductivity and recyclability further contribute to its popularity in casting applications. With the growing demand for lightweight materials, energy efficiency, and sustainability, the Aluminum segment continues to dominate the Non-ferrous Castings Market, catering to diverse industrial requirements.
The Automobiles segment is the fastest-growing segment in the Non-ferrous Castings Market. The global automotive industry is undergoing a significant transformation, with a shift towards lightweight materials to improve fuel efficiency and reduce emissions. Non-ferrous castings, such as aluminum and magnesium alloys, are preferred in automobile manufacturing due to their lightweight nature and excellent strength-to-weight ratio. Additionally, the increasing demand for electric vehicles (EVs) further propels the growth of non-ferrous castings in automobiles, as these materials are essential for producing components like motor casings and battery housings. Further, advancements in casting technologies, such as high-pressure die casting and squeeze casting, are enhancing the efficiency and quality of non-ferrous automotive parts, driving further adoption in the industry. As automotive manufacturers continue to prioritize sustainability and performance, the demand for non-ferrous castings in the Automobiles segment is expected to continue its rapid ascent in the coming years.
